- Which region consumes the most plasticizers in the world?
- Over 90% of the plasticizers are consumed in flexible PVC applications . China is the single largest plasticizer market in the world, followed by other Asian region, Europe and North America. The figure below shows the global plasticizer consumption by region in 2017 . Global Plasticizer Consumption in 1000 MT by Region in 2017

- What polymers use plasticizers?
- Approximately 90% of these plasticizers are used in the production of plasticized or flexible polyvinyl chloride (PVC) products. Other polymer systems that use small amounts of plasticizers include polyvinyl butyral (PVB), acrylic polymers, poly (vinylidene chloride), nylon, polyolefins, polyurethanes, and certain fluoroplastics.
- What are plasticizers & how do they work?
- Plasticizers are non-volatile organic substances (mainly liquids) added into a plastic or elastomer. They are also usually cheaper than other additives. They improve the following properties of the polymers: Plasticizers increase the flow and thermoplasticity of a polymer.
